Remote Workday LMS Admin
Insight Global
The Compliance Learning Coordinator will assist in the development, implementation, and management of compliance training programs. This role involves supporting various departments to ensure that all employees understand and adhere to regulatory requirements and internal policies. Reporting experience and expert-level Excel knowledge are crucial for this role.
Collaborate with the compliance team to identify training needs and address compliance issues.
Identify all current compliance learning assignments and create an updated inventory of required compliance learning for all colleagues globally.
Build compliance learning pathways and assignment groups within the Learning Management System.
Assist in the development and implementation of compliance training programs for special projects.
Prepare and analyze reports on training outcomes and compliance metrics using advanced Excel skills.
Monitor and assess the effectiveness of training programs and provide feedback for improvements.
Stay informed about the latest developments in compliance regulations and best practices.
